Verdict: which is better?

Toolip advertises very cheap residential, datacenter and ISP proxies (from $0.01) on an 81M pool with a modest review count. ProxyScrape swaps ISP for mobile, has a larger 120M pool and a deeper 499-review base. Both are ultra-cheap; ProxyScrape edges ahead on scale and review depth.

ProxyScrape vs Toolip FAQ

Is ProxyScrape cheaper than Toolip?

Toolip has the lower entry price at $0.01 per GB, compared with $0.03 per IP for ProxyScrape. Always size the cost to your real monthly usage, since per-GB and per-IP plans scale differently.

Which has a bigger proxy network, ProxyScrape or Toolip?

ProxyScrape lists the larger IP pool at 120M+, while Toolip lists 81M+. A larger pool usually means more unique IPs and lower block rates at scale.
